Research Abstract |
In the present study, we examined the effect of elevated muscle temperature on muscle metabolism. As results, we provided evidence that elevated muscle temperature per se has exercise-like effects on rat skeletal muscle. This emphasizes the potential role that elevated muscle temperature may play in the regulation of muscle metabolisms during exercise.
